Enlivex Therapeutics Ltd., established in 2005 and based in Nes Ziona, Israel, operates as a clinical-stage biotechnology firm dedicated to macrophage reprogramming immunotherapy. The company is currently advancing Allocetra, its flagship cell-based therapeutic. This treatment is undergoing Phase II clinical evaluation for its effectiveness in addressing organ dysfunction and failure that arises from sepsis.
